The audio quality (5.1 surround sound) is critical for experiencing John Williams’ haunting score. Williams, known for triumphant fanfares in Star Wars or Indiana Jones , delivers a radically different composition for Munich . It is a minimalist, aching work featuring a guitar and orchestra that underscores the tragedy rather than the triumph. A 5.1 mix allows the ambient sounds of the era and the subtle sound design of explosions to envelop the viewer, placing them inside Avner’s head.

Released in 2005 and directed by the legendary Steven Spielberg, Munich is a powerful historical drama and spy thriller. The film is based on the true story of "Operation Wrath of God"—the secret Israeli government retaliation following the shocking massacre of 11 Israeli athletes by the Palestinian terrorist group Black September during the 1972 Munich Olympic Games.
